India’s rising leg-spinner Varun Chakravarthy took his first ODI five-wicket haul to help the team secure a 44-run win over New Zealand in Dubai. The performance has raised eyebrows, particularly with the upcoming semi-final against Australia.
Former India leg-spinner Anil Kumble praised Varun for his exceptional display, saying it would encourage India ahead of their semi-final and potential final at the same venue. Kumble noted that Varun’s consistency is impressive, having consistently won matches for teams he has played for in the past year.
Varun bowled 10 overs, dismissing New Zealand’s Will Young, Glenn Phillips, Michael Bracewell, and Mitchell Santner before getting his fifth wicket, Matt Henry. The spin attack, including four spinners, posed a significant challenge for Australia, according to Kumble.
India’s semi-final match is scheduled against Australia at the same venue, where Varun’s impressive display suggests that India’s spin strength could play a crucial role in their chances of success.
